Soccer Player Gael Lafont Joins Genoa
Lafont leaves Marseille to sign with Italian club Genoa.

Gael Lafont, a professional soccer player, has completed a transfer from French club Marseille to join Italian club Genoa. The move was announced by both clubs.
Why it matters
Lafont's transfer is noteworthy as it represents a shift in his career, moving from a prominent French club to an Italian club, which could signal a new chapter in his soccer journey.
The details
Genoa, an Italian soccer club, has acquired Gael Lafont from Marseille, a French Ligue 1 club. The details of the transfer, including the fee and contract length, have not been disclosed by the clubs.
- Lafont's transfer to Genoa was completed on March 21, 2026.
